Usar jarfix.exe para reparar la asociación de archivos .jar cuando SAB / RAB / DAB no se inicia en Windows

He ayudado a algunos colegas que han tenido el problema de que no sucede nada cuando intentan iniciar SAB / RAB / DAB desde su menú o icono o cualquier otra manera de ejecutar el archivo *-app-builder.jar. Una herramienta que ha resuelto este problema de que una computadora no reconoce qué hacer con un archivo .jar (o hace algo incorrecto con un archivo .jar) es una utilidad llamada jarfix.exe publicada como “freeware” por Johann Johann Löfflman. Como lo describe en su página web,

“En Windows, cualquier programa puede robar [la asociación] de un tipo de archivo en cualquier momento, incluso cuando ya está asociado con un programa. Muchos programas zip / unzip prefieren hacer esto, porque un jar se almacena en formato .zip. Si el usuario hace doble clic en un .jar, su programa de zip abre el archivo, en lugar de que javaw ejecute el programa, porque su programa de zip ignora la metainformación que también está almacenada en un .jar

Este problema se puede solucionar muy fácilmente con el pequeño pero confiable programa jarfix.exe. Simplemente haga doble clic en él para restaurar la asociación .jar con javaw.exe ".

He visto este problema más de una vez; cada vez que tenemos un taller de creación de aplicaciones (que generalmente incluye de 15 a 20 participantes) parece que tenemos una o dos personas cuyas máquinas no pueden abrir los archivos .jar correctamente. La reparación de la asociación de archivos con esta herramienta ha resuelto el problema la mayoría del tiempo, así que quería documentarlo aquí y sugerir que sería bueno incluso incluir esto en la sección de solución de problemas de las instrucciones de instalación.

1 Like

Muchas gracias Bruce por compartir esta solución!